Hr Morning - Afternoon Northeast Georgia Health System is rooted in
a foundation of improving the health of our communities. About the
Role: Job Summary Responsible for providing comprehensive
assessment, planning, implementation and overall evaluation of
individual patient needs; Works collaborate with the Physicians,
patient/family, nursing, utilization review and other members of
the healthcare team to assure patient management that efficiently
and effectively aligns with patient needs using resources to meet
quality, clinical and cost effective outcomes. Coordinates a team
approach designed to facilitate the achievement of expected patient
outcomes with appropriate transitions to the next level of care;
Responsible for length of stay management, regulatory compliance,
and attending/participating with interdisciplinary team rounds on
assigned unit; Collaborates with community providers to facilitate
and coordinate the plan of care for post-hospitalization needs of
the patient. This position will come in contact with patients in
the neonate, infant, child, adolescent, adult, and geriatric age
groups; Employees will perform clinical duties in accordance with
population specific guidelines and adhere to National Patient
Safety Guidelines. Provides cross coverage for all RNCM as required
across all settings in the care continuum, including weekend
rotation (as needed). Minimum Job Qualifications Licensure or other
certifications: Licensed to practice as an RN in Georgia.
Educational Requirements: Associates Degree. Graduate of an
accredited school of nursing. Minimum Experience: Three ( 3) to
five (5) years of experience in direct patient care and/or case
management. Financial and discharge planning experience. Other:

Essential Tasks and Responsibilities Monitor all patients on
assigned units to ensure appropriate use of resources and
interventions while managing patient's length of stay based on
working DRG/admitting diagnosis. Communicates with Physician,
patient/family, and other disciplines the expected length of stay,
along with patient progress towards discharge. Provides
coordination and facilitation oversight of patient care to assure
required interventions occur in proper sequence and processes occur
in a timely manner without delays. Identifies and acts upon
potential delays in services; escalates unresolved delays to
management for appropriate intervention. Assess, coordinate and
facilitate patient's discharge plan to assure post-acute needs are
arranged and secured prior to discharge; Communicate discharge plan
with Physician, patient/family, and other members of the healthcare
team as appropriate; Reassess discharge plan routinely throughout
patient's stay to ensure timely, safe discharge and appropriate
transition to the next level of care. Provides patient/family with
information regarding their plan of care, discharge and any
financial responsibility of inpatient or post-hospitalization
services. Maintain knowledge of reimbursement methodologies and
general coverage guidelines for all levels of inpatient and
outpatient care. Communicate with Physician, patient/family or
other team members as needed to ensure services will be covered.
Coordinate and communicate with Utilization Review Nurse on a
daily, consistent basis to ensure patients are in the right status
and level of care. Facilitate changes by communicating with
Physician, mid-level or nursing staff as needed. Serve as liaison
to patients family, Physicians, nursing staff and all other
disciplines to achieve optimal outcomes in the development of
patient's discharge plan. Serve as a leader on assigned unit in the
areas of discharge planning, social service issues, community
resources/referrals and financial information related to patient
care and outcomes. Empowered to think outside of the box to
consistently create new, and effective solutions to complex
problems or opportunities. Actively supports a customer service
oriented environment to continually enhance customer service;
Communicates directly with Physicians, nursing staff,
patient/family and other disciplines to ensure collaborative
practice. Provide appropriate hand-off communication as patients
transition from one unit to another to ensure and achieve optimal
outcomes. Maintains positive attitude, and communicates
appropriately with patients/families, Physician, management and
other staff; responds positively to change and offers suggestions
to effectively incorporate change as needed in daily workflow.
Maintain detailed knowledge of community resources, governmental
regulations, third party payers (PPO/HMO's) to facilitate
appropriate outcomes. Adheres to all regulatory and DNV
requirements; Knowledgeable of third party/governmental payer
regulatory requirements and adheres to appropriate processes.
Completes paperwork as required. Consistently demonstrates a 'sense
of urgency' in his/her work, while mindful of the pillars and
financial stewardship opportunities. Works all scheduled shifts,
including weekend rotation, and remote coverage. Physical Demands
